Soldiers should fight with tech as good as they ‘use at home,’ Army secretary demands

Army Secretary Demands Modern Technology for Soldiers

Army Secretary Dan Driscoll pledged to adopt a Silicon Valley-like approach to weapons and tech development and procurement at the AUSA Conference.

"No one can predict the next war, but we cannot wait — we cannot f------ wait to innovate until Americans are dying on the battlefield,"

Driscoll emphasized the need for innovation, stating that soldiers should have access to technology as good as what they use at home. He expressed his distaste for the service's slow acquisition system, highlighting the importance of acting now to enable soldiers.
